Carl Sprague: Setting the Stage at the Opalka Gallery

Opalka Gallery is pleased to present Carl Sprague: Setting the Stage, a solo retrospective exhibition, on view January 23 through February 24. Carl Sprague’s remarkable career as a designer spans stage and screen. He has worked in the art departments of more than 40 films, which between them have a combined total of 35 Oscar nominations. Though he has worked with Martin Scorsese (The Age of Innocence), Steven Spielberg (Amistad), and Damien Chazelle (La La Land), the most enduring collaboration has been with Wes Anderson with whom he has worked on six films.
